DENVER (AP) — Los Angeles Dodgers designated hitter Shohei Ohtani hit his 54th homer of the season on Friday night against Colorado after earlier stealing base No. 57 to pass Ichiro Suzuki for the most in a single season by a Japanese-born player.

Ohtani launched a towering three-run blast into the second deck at Coors Field in the sixth inning on a changeup from Colorado Rockies reliever Anthony Molina. Ohtani has a National League-leading 54 homers as he chases a possible Triple Crown. He entered the night with a .305 average, which trailed Luis Arráez (.312) and Marcell Ozuna (.310).
